(Chris Ensing/CBC – image credit) A 17-year-old woman has died in a crash that injured three others near Blenheim Thursday night, Chatham-Kent police say. Emergency crews responded around 9:45 p.m. to a single-car crash on Allison Line, west of Blenheim.

Police say the car was travelling northeast when the driver lost control of the vehicle and rolled several times before landing on its roof. There were four people in the car Three people, a 16-year-old and two 17-year olds, were transported to hospital with injuries not considered to be life-threatening.

A 17-year-old woman was pronounced dead at the scene.

In a statement, police said the investigation by the traffic management unit is ongoing.

“The Chatham-Kent Police Service would like to express our sincere condolences to the family and friends of this young woman, as well as to everyone impacted by this tragic collision.”
